About the Group:
- Founded in 2011 out of a desire to create an alternative option for diagnostic services to the large health systems
- 4 Different locations across the Houston area
- Over 100 total employees with 12 providers across different specialties
- Delivering a broad range of medical services, including diagnostic imaging, emergency care, medical evaluations, pain management, and orthopedic services
- Proudly offer MRIs, CTs, X-Rays, and Ultrasounds across various locations in the greater Houston area.
- Advanced diagnostic Radiology Services and Interventional Pain. We also do medical consults for personal injury cases

About this role:
- Interventional Pain Physician
- Clinic Location: Bellaire, TX
- M-F: 8-6pm
- Position is open due to a growing practice and patient base. Group works with a high number of personal injury patients. Not workman's comp.
- work closely with orthopedic surgeons, radiology, and rehabilitation teams, delivering timely, evidence-based care for patients with acute and injury-related pain conditions
- Including personal injury cases. Our model is designed to support efficient workflows, strong procedural volume, and high-quality outcomes.
- Procedure heavy position, not utilizing a lot of narcotics
- In office procedure based or surgery center based. Option to provide both.
- New patient consults, epidural steroid injections, medial branch blocks, facet blocks, transforaminal epidural steroid injection
- 30 patients per day
- 3 MAs per physician
- Evaluate and treat patients with acute and injury-related pain conditions
- Develop clear, individualized treatment plans using interventional procedures, medication management, and adjunct therapies
- Perform image-guided procedures including epidural steroid injections, facet blocks, nerve blocks, joint injections, and related interventions
- Collaborate closely with orthopedic surgeons, radiology, physical therapy, and care coordination teams to ensure timely, coordinated care
- Communicate treatment plans, expectations, and outcomes clearly to patients
- Maintain accurate, timely documentation appropriate for interventional and injury-based care models
- Stay current with best practices and evolving techniques in interventional pain management
